FWIW, you can only get two degrees from TESU. So, if you get Psych "for now" and then Comp Sci from them later, you can't go back and get a business degree (if you find you need one to get a promotion) from TESU; you'd have to go elsewhere. On the other hand, if you do both Psych and Comp Sci at the same time, that only counts as a single degree. Getting a dual degree can still be faster & easier than getting a single degree at a more traditional school.

Yes, they just didn't realize that Berkeley's course numbering system is funky, I'm not at all surprised they updated those for you.
Yes, I would definitely take the ACTFL exams for credit - especially if you can get the OPI or WPT exams which have UL credit. Each exam is worth 12cr (6UL and 6LL) if you score high enough.
